Impaired glucose tolerance and future cardiovascular risk after coronary revascularization: a 10-year follow-up report

2019
Aims Practical management guidelines for impaired glucose tolerance(IGT) have not been established. Although IGT is a potent marker of cardiovascular disease (CVD), it is still controversial whether its magnitude of CVD risk is comparable to that of frank diabetes. Moreover, information on long-term clinical outcomes of IGT patients undergoing coronary revascularizationis limited. The aim of the present work was to investigate the 10-year prognostic impact of IGT in comparison with diabetes in patients with CAD undergoing coronary revascularization.
